Bad Bunny (Benito Antonio Martínez Ocasio) was born on March 10, 1994, in San Juan, Puerto Rico. Bad Bunny’s astrological sign is Pisces.

Bad Bunny is a rapper, signer/songwriter, actor and model who first rose to fame in 2016 when his song “Diles” exploded on SoundCloud. That success led to a record deal and his first hit single, “Soy Peor” which has amassed more than a billion views on YouTube. He entered the mainstream in 2018 with release of his debut album, X 100PRE, and a collab with Cardi B, “I Like It,” on HER debut album.

Bad Bunny’s star has been on a meteoric rise since 2020 when he appeared at the NFL Super Bowl Halftime show, headlined by Shakira and J.Lo. The NFL tapped Bad Bunny to be the headline artist for its February 8, 2026, Super Bowl LX Halftime show.

In Puerto Rico, Bad Bunny is more than another pop star, he is an economic catalyst. His three-month, 30-show concert residency in San Juan in 2025 was estimated by The New York Times to have infused $400m into the island’s economy during the traditionally slower tourism months of hurricane season. When he performs at the 60th Super Bowl in 2026, he’ll be at the beginning of an eight-month world tour that is expected to amass ticket sales that eclipse those of Taylor Swift and Beyonce despite not including the U.S. (more on that later).

“What I’m feeling goes beyond myself,” Bad Bunny said in a statement shared by the NFL about being chosen to headline the 2026 Super Bowl Halftime show. “This is for my people, my culture, and our history.”

Bad Bunny leans into his roots and it hasn’t stopped him from being one of the world’s largest stars. He’s the second most streamed artist in Spotify’s history, behind only Taylor Swift and in a Top 20 list crowded by stars like Drake, The Weeknd, Justin Bieber, Kendrick Lamar and Billie Eilish.
